Violinist
Greek National Opera
Argyro Sira graduated from the Hellenic Conservatory, where she studied violin under Stelios Kafantaris, earning a first prize and special distinction. She continued her studies in France with scholarships from the State Scholarships Foundation (IKY), the Onassis Foundation, and the French Government. She studied with Le Dizes and Dogarey at the Higher Conservatories of Boulogne and Bordeaux, graduating with the highest distinctions and awards, and served as an assistant professor at the Conservatory of Boulogne.
Sira has worked with the national orchestras of Metz, Nancy, and Bayonne, as well as the Symphony and Opera of Bordeaux. She also played with the Camerata – Friends of Music Orchestra as concertmaster until 2000. Since 2001, she has been the principal first violinist in the second violins of the Greek National Opera Orchestra.
She was a member of the World Youth Orchestra, recorded for French, Belgian, Dutch, and Greek Radio, and was a founding member of the Skalkottas Ensemble. As a soloist, she has collaborated with the Bordeaux Youth Orchestra, the Greek Radio Orchestra, the Camerata, and the Thessaloniki State Symphony Orchestra. Sira is also a graduate of the Faculty of Philosophy at the National and Kapodistrian University of Athens.
